了解服务器防御的重要性

随着互联网的普及,服务器已成为企业、个人获取信息、开展业务的重要平台,服务器面临着来自网络攻击的威胁,如DDoS攻击、SQL注入、跨站脚本攻击等,制作有效的服务器防御措施至关重要。
服务器防御制作步骤
确定服务器类型
根据服务器所承载的业务类型,确定其安全需求,游戏服务器、邮件服务器、数据库服务器等,它们的安全需求各有侧重。
安装防火墙
防火墙是服务器防御的第一道防线,可以有效阻止非法访问,选择一款适合自己服务器类型的防火墙,并配置相应的安全策略。
开启安全防护功能
大多数操作系统都提供了安全防护功能,如Windows的Windows Defender、Linux的iptables等,开启这些功能,可以有效防御恶意攻击。
定期更新系统
操作系统和应用程序的漏洞是攻击者入侵的主要途径,定期更新系统,修复已知漏洞,降低攻击风险。
数据备份与恢复

定期备份服务器数据,确保在遭受攻击时能够快速恢复,制定应急预案,提高应对突发事件的能力。
防止SQL注入
SQL注入是常见的网络攻击手段,通过在用户输入的数据中插入恶意SQL代码,实现对数据库的攻击,为防止SQL注入,可采取以下措施:
a. 对用户输入进行过滤和验证;
b. 使用参数化查询;
c. 对数据库进行权限控制。
防止跨站脚本攻击(XSS)
跨站脚本攻击是利用网页漏洞,在用户浏览网页时执行恶意脚本,为防止XSS攻击,可采取以下措施:
a. 对用户输入进行编码处理;
b. 使用内容安全策略(CSP);
c. 对网页进行安全编码。

防止DDoS攻击
DDoS攻击通过大量请求占用服务器资源,导致正常用户无法访问,为防止DDoS攻击,可采取以下措施:
a. 使用DDoS防护设备;
b. 配置BGP黑洞;
c. 与第三方DDoS防护服务商合作。
服务器防御FAQs
Q1:如何判断服务器是否遭受攻击?
A1:观察服务器性能,如CPU、内存、磁盘使用率等,若发现异常波动,可能表明服务器遭受攻击。
Q2:服务器防御措施有哪些?
A2:服务器防御措施包括安装防火墙、开启安全防护功能、定期更新系统、数据备份与恢复、防止SQL注入、防止跨站脚本攻击、防止DDoS攻击等。
